/* 

D O N ' T    T O U C H    M Y    S T U F F

Copyright (c) 2008 by Cityweb Indonesia.  All Rights Reserved.
http://www.citywebindo.com - sales@citywebindo.com

*/

body {
	margin: 0;
	padding: 0;
	text-align: center;
	font: normal 12px Arial;
	color: #666462;
	background: #fff url(images/bg_all.jpg) repeat-x top left;
	line-height: 16px;
	}

a:link, a:visited, a:active {
	font: normal 12px Arial;
	color: #d60000;
	}

a:hover {
	color: #1e3378;
	}

#container {
	margin: 0 auto;
	padding: 0;
	text-align: left;
	width: 852px;
	}

#logotikijne {
	width: 164px;
	height: 92px;
	background: transparent url(images/logo.png) no-repeat top left;
	text-indent: -9999px;
	}

.bahasa {
	font: normal 11px Arial;
	color: #b5bcd3;
	}

.bahasa a:link, .bahasa a:visited, .bahasa a:active {
	font: normal 11px Arial;
	color: #b5bcd3;
	text-decoration: none;
	}

.bahasa a:hover {
	color: #fffc00;
	}

.menutop {
	font: normal 11px Arial;
	color: #f5f5f5;
	}

.menutop a:link, .menutop a:visited, .menutop a:active {
	font: normal 11px Arial;
	color: #f5f5f5;
	text-decoration: none;
	}

.menutop a:hover {
	color: #fffc00;
	}

.inputsearch {
	background-color: #5c6b9c;
	width: 115px;
	border: #5c6b9c;
	}

.inputsearch:focus {
	background-color: #fff;
	}

.btnsearch {
	background-color: #1e3378;
	border: 0;
	font: bold 13px Arial;
	color: #f5f5f5;
	cursor: pointer;
	}

a#company {
	background: transparent url(images/btn_company.png) no-repeat top left;
	width: 106px;
	height: 20px;
	text-indent: -9999px;
	display: block;
	}

* html a#company {
	background-image: none;
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/btn_company.png", sizingMethod="image");
	display: block;
	cursor: pointer;
	width: 106px;
	height: 20px;
	}

a:hover#company {
	background: transparent url(images/btn_company_hover.png) no-repeat top left;
	width: 106px;
	height: 20px;
	text-indent: -9999px;
	display: block;
	}

* html a:hover#company {
	background-image: none;
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/btn_company_hover.png", sizingMethod="image");
	display: block;
	cursor: pointer;
	width: 106px;
	height: 20px;
	}

a#services {
	background: transparent url(images/btn_services.png) no-repeat top left;
	width: 130px;
	height: 20px;
	text-indent: -9999px;
	display: block;
	}

* html a#services {
	background-image: none;
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/btn_services.png", sizingMethod="image");
	display: block;
	cursor: pointer;
	width: 130px;
	height: 20px;
	}

a:hover#services {
	background: transparent url(images/btn_services_hover.png) no-repeat top left;
	width: 130px;
	height: 20px;
	text-indent: -9999px;
	display: block;
	}
	
* html a:hover#services {
	background-image: none;
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/btn_services_hover.png", sizingMethod="image");
	display: block;
	cursor: pointer;
	wwidth: 130px;
	height: 20px;
	}

a#network {
	background: transparent url(images/btn_network.png) no-repeat top left;
	width: 108px;
	height: 20px;
	text-indent: -9999px;
	display: block;
	}

* html a#network {
	background-image: none;
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/btn_network.png", sizingMethod="image");
	display: block;
	cursor: pointer;
	width: 108px;
	height: 20px;
	}

a:hover#network {
	background: transparent url(images/btn_network_hover.png) no-repeat top left;
	width: 108px;
	height: 20px;
	text-indent: -9999px;
	display: block;
	}

* html a:hover#network {
	background-image: none;
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/btn_network_hover.png", sizingMethod="image");
	display: block;
	cursor: pointer;
	width: 108px;
	height: 20px;
	}

a#newspromo {
	background: transparent url(images/btn_newspromo.png) no-repeat top left;
	width: 179px;
	height: 20px;
	text-indent: -9999px;
	display: block;
	}

* html a#newspromo {
	background-image: none;
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/btn_newspromo.png", sizingMethod="image");
	display: block;
	cursor: pointer;
	width: 179px;
	height: 20px;
	}

a:hover#newspromo {
	background: transparent url(images/btn_newspromo_hover.png) no-repeat top left;
	width: 179px;
	height: 20px;
	text-indent: -9999px;
	display: block;
	}

* html a:hover#newspromo {
	background-image: none;
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/btn_newspromo_hover.png", sizingMethod="image");
	display: block;
	cursor: pointer;
	width: 179px;
	height: 20px;
	}

a#business {
	background: transparent url(images/btn_business.png) no-repeat top left;
	width: 190px;
	height: 20px;
	text-indent: -9999px;
	display: block;
	}

* html a#business {
	background-image: none;
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/btn_business.png", sizingMethod="image");
	display: block;
	cursor: pointer;
	width: 190px;
	height: 20px;
	}

a:hover#business {
	background: transparent url(images/btn_business_hover.png) no-repeat top left;
	width: 190px;
	height: 20px;
	text-indent: -9999px;
	display: block;
	}

* html a:hover#business {
	background-image: none;
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/btn_business_hover.png", sizingMethod="image");
	display: block;
	cursor: pointer;
	width: 190px;
	height: 20px;
	}

a#clients {
	background: transparent url(images/btn_clients.png) no-repeat top left;
	width: 90px;
	height: 20px;
	text-indent: -9999px;
	display: block;
	}

* html a#clients {
	background-image: none;
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/btn_clients.png", sizingMethod="image");
	display: block;
	cursor: pointer;
	width: 90px;
	height: 20px;
	}

a:hover#clients {
	background: transparent url(images/btn_clients_hover.png) no-repeat top left;
	width: 90px;
	height: 20px;
	text-indent: -9999px;
	display: block;
	}

* html a:hover#clients {
	background-image: none;
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/btn_clients_hover.png", sizingMethod="image");
	display: block;
	cursor: pointer;
	width: 90px;
	height: 20px;
	}

.lengkungatas1 {
	background: transparent url(images/lengkung_atas.gif) no-repeat bottom left;
	width: 277px;
	height: 14px;
	}

.lengkungatas5 {
	background: transparent url(images/lengkungatas5.gif) no-repeat bottom left;
	width: 277px;
	height: 14px;
	}

.bg1 {
	background: transparent url(images/bg_area1.gif) repeat-y top left;
	}

.lengkungbawah1 {
	background: transparent url(images/lengkung_bawah.gif) no-repeat top left;
	width: 277px;
	height: 14px;
	}

.subtitle {
	font: bold 14px Arial;
	color: #002733;
	background: transparent url(images/dot.gif) no-repeat 0px 1px;
	padding-left: 20px;
	margin-bottom: 10px;
	}

.judul, .judul a:link, .judul a:visited, .judul a:hover {
	font: bold 12px Arial;
	color: #d80000;
	text-decoration: none;
	margin-bottom: 5px;
	}

.judul a:hover {
	color: #1e3378;
	}

a#pickuporder {
	background: transparent url(images/btn_pickup_order.gif) no-repeat top left;
	width: 277px;
	height: 72px;
	text-indent: -9999px;
	display: block;
	}

.inputcheck {
	border: 1px solid #d4d4d4;
	background-color: #fff;
	width: 175px;
	padding: 3px 0;
	}

/* hack for ie7 */
*:first-child+html .inputcheck {
	width: 200px;
	}
/* hack for ie7 */

/* hack for ie6 or bellow */
* html .inputcheck {
	width: 200px;
	}
/* hack for ie6 or bellow */

.inputcheck:focus {
	background-color: #ccc1e8;
	}

.btnsubmit {
	background: url(images/btn_submit.gif) no-repeat top left;
	width: 60px;
	height: 18px;
	display: block;
	cursor: pointer;
	border: 0;
	text-indent: -9999px;
	}

.content {
	font: normal 12px Arial;
	line-height: 16px;
	}

.lengkungatas2 {
	background: transparent url(images/lengkung_atas2.gif) no-repeat bottom left;
	width: 262px;
	height: 14px;
	}

.bg2 {
	background: transparent url(images/bg_area2.gif) repeat-y top left;
	}

.lengkungbawah2 {
	background: transparent url(images/lengkung_bawah2.gif) no-repeat top left;
	width: 262px;
	height: 14px;
	}

.lengkungatas3 {
	background: transparent url(images/lengkungatas3.gif) no-repeat bottom left;
	width: 232px;
	height: 11px;
	}

.bg3 {
	background: transparent url(images/bg3.gif) repeat-y top left;
	}

.lengkungbawah3 {
	background: transparent url(images/lengkungbawah3.gif) no-repeat top left;
	width: 232px;
	height: 11px;
	}

.btnsearch2 {
	background: transparent url(images/btn_search.gif) no-repeat top right;
	width: 60px;
	height: 18px;
	text-indent: -9999px;
	display: block;
	border: 0;
	float: right;
	cursor: pointer;
	}

#footer {
	margin: 0 auto;
	padding: 0;
	background: transparent url(images/bg_footer.gif) repeat-x bottom left;
	height: 131px;
	text-align: center;
	width: 100%;
	}

.logologo {
	background: transparent url(images/logo2.gif) no-repeat bottom right;
	width: 417px;
	height: 83px;
	text-align: right;
	}

.copyright {
	color: #546498;
	font: normal 10px Arial;
	line-height: 14px;
	}

.copyright a:link, .copyright a:visited, .copyright a:active {
	color: #546498;
	font: normal 10px Arial;
	text-decoration: none;
	border-bottom: 1px dotted #546498;
	}

.copyright a:hover {
	color: #fff;
	}

.lengkungatas4 {
	background: transparent url(images/lengkungatas4.gif) no-repeat bottom left;
	width: 557px;
	height: 14px;
	}

.bg4 {
	background: transparent url(images/bg4.gif) repeat-y top left;
	}

.lengkungbawah4 {
	background: transparent url(images/lengkungbawah4.gif) no-repeat top left;
	width: 557px;
	height: 14px;
	}

.tanggal {
	font: normal 11px Arial;
	}

.gambar{
	float:left;
	margin:0px 10px 0px 0px;
	padding:3px;
	border:1px solid #666666;
}

/* Additional */
.trackH {background: #1e3377;text-align: center;color: #fff;}
.trackC {background: #e0e0e0;text-align: left;color: #000;}
.trfH {background: #1e3377;color: #fff;margin-left: 2px;}
.trfC {background: #e0e0e0;text-align: left;color: #000;}

.btnback {
	background: url(images/btn_back.gif) no-repeat top left;
	width: 60px;
	height: 18px;
	display: block;
	cursor: pointer;
	border: 0;
	text-indent: -9999px;
	}
